Transport services offered
Enclosed shifting is the most secure moving option for classic, vintage, and high-value automobiles. The cars travel in a fully enclosed carrier, which offers protection from external forces like the weather.
Open-air hauling: Many uncovered trucks offer some of the most affordable moving solutions. Smaller flatbed trucks help us navigate the street clearance when collecting or delivering at your address. Multi-car trailers are the cheapest long-distance solution for hauling.
Terminal-to-terminal relocation: We have authorized entry into almost all the major transportation depots in the country. You can drop off or pick up the vehicle at the nearest hub in your state.
Door-to-door shipping: If you can't get to the transportation depot, we can fetch it or drop it off at your residence. We can always find the closest address if you live in a hard-to-reach neighborhood.
International RoRo: Standing for roll-on/roll-off, RoRo is the cheapest way to send your vehicle overseas. Some of the transport vessels we use can carry close to 6000 cars at once, lowering the costs even further.
Containerized transport: Container shipping helps to secure the cargo from potential damage while at sea. We can place your vehicle in a shared or dedicated option depending on your budget.
Air transport: If you want your car delivered in the shortest time globally, we can send it on the next available flight. It is usually an expensive affair that we only recommend for certain high-end vehicles and special occasions.

How to prepare for hauling?
The Department of Transportation (DOT) prohibits car shipping companies from transporting vehicles packed with household goods. The insurance policy often does not cover aftermarket accessories like DVD players and GPS. Get them removed to prevent possible damage.
Wash the vehicle. Walk around the exterior while recording all the chips, dents, and scratches on the body. You may use a camera to take dated photographs of the cosmetic damage and share the records with the truck driver at the collection.
Leave the gas tank with about a quarter of fuel. We might have to start the car and drive on or off the truck when loading and unloading. Avoid keeping too much as it might compromise your vehicle's weight.
Get your vehicle checked by a professional to fix the mechanical problems. If you don't have enough time, write a note detailing the issues and share it with the truck driver. Check the battery and keep it on a full charge, keep the tires well inflated, and top off the fluid levels.
Disable the alarm system so it doesn't cause unnecessary interruptions during transportation. Toll tags and parking passes might attract charges along the highway. Keep them deactivated or get them removed.

How long does it take to ship a car to or from Los Banos, CA?
Most shipments to or from Los Banos take 2 to 7 days for regional moves and 7 to 10 days for cross-country transport. Timing depends on distance, carrier availability, and scheduling flexibility. Rural pickup areas around Merced County may add 1–2 days. Weather conditions in California’s Central Valley and traffic on major corridors like I-5 can also influence delivery timelines.

Is door-to-door car transport available in Los Banos?
Yes, door-to-door service is widely available in Los Banos and nearby areas. Carriers pick up and deliver your vehicle as close as safely possible to your address. However, narrow rural roads or farm access routes may require meeting at a nearby parking lot or highway access point. This option saves time and avoids terminal drop-offs. How do I prepare my vehicle for car transport in Los Banos?
Start by cleaning your vehicle and documenting its condition with photos. Remove personal items, disable alarms, and keep fuel at about one-quarter tank. Check for leaks and ensure the battery is charged. These steps help meet FMCSA transport guidelines and prevent delays. Proper preparation also protects your vehicle during loading, especially in hot Central Valley conditions where temperatures can exceed 90°F in summer.
